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
999137 70 96585897282
536945 02406 84529064
536945 02406 84529064
72929 65120640750 4909000 760568
All about undefined
Interested in learning more?
536945 02406 84529064
72929 65120640750 4909000 760568
See more
621132 75944044497
645446 757571 30 488
See more
3354213 5396
929 78808260 4598
See more